Abstract
A system for generating a query plan is provided. In some example embodiments, the system performs operations comprising: determining, at a query execution engine, a first primitive call for implementing a query operation on data at a database; performing the query operation by at least sending, to a data management engine coupled to the database, the first primitive call for execution by the data management engine; and determining, based at least on a result of the first primitive call, a result of the query operation. Related methods and articles of manufacture, including computer program products, are also described.
